Uncovering the Best WinSshFS 4every1 Alternatives for Seamless Remote Access
WinSshFS 4every1, a clone of win-sshfs, has served many users by providing a convenient way to mount remote computers via SFTP as local network drives. With its improvements over the original, including an updated Renci SSH and fixes for various bugs, it's been a stable solution for many. However, as with any software, users may seek different features, broader platform support, or simply explore other robust options. MobaXterm
MobaXterm is an advanced terminal for Windows users, offering a powerful, Unix-like command-line experience. It's an excellent WinSshFS 4every1 alternative due to its comprehensive features like SFTP support, an embedded Xserver, a built-in SSH client, and RDP functionality, all within a customizable, tabbed interface. Available as Freemium software for Windows, MobaXterm provides an integrated environment for various remote access protocols, making it a versatile tool for developers and system administrators.

ExpanDrive
ExpanDrive allows you to map or mount a wide array of cloud storage services and protocols, including SFTP, WebDAV, and S3, as a network drive. This commercial software for Mac, Windows, and Linux offers seamless access to files without local syncing, making it a powerful WinSshFS 4every1 alternative. Its features include extensive cloud integration (Dropbox, Google Drive, OneDrive, Amazon S3), a virtual filesystem, and Windows Explorer extension, providing a highly integrated experience for managing remote files.

NetDrive
NetDrive is a commercial remote storage tool available for Mac and Windows that allows you to access your cloud files as if they were on a local disk. As a strong WinSshFS 4every1 alternative, it focuses on ease of use and broad protocol support, including Amazon S3 and WebDAV. Its ability to integrate with various cloud storage services and mount them as local drives makes it a convenient solution for users needing straightforward access to remote data.

WebDrive
WebDrive is a commercial software for Mac and Windows that puts the cloud on your desktop, enabling access to Amazon S3, Dropbox, Google Drive, OneDrive, and more. It functions similarly to WinSshFS 4every1 by allowing you to edit files on corporate SFTP and SharePoint Servers as if they were local. Key features include support for SFTP, WebDAV, Amazon S3, and direct upload capabilities to popular cloud services, making it a robust option for unified remote file management.

win-sshfs
win-sshfs is the open-source predecessor upon which WinSshFS 4every1 is based, made using Dokan and SSH.NET library. As a free and open-source solution for Windows, it allows you to mount remote computers via SFTP protocol like Windows network drives. For users seeking the core functionality of WinSshFS 4every1 in an open-source package, win-sshfs remains a viable and direct alternative, offering essential SFTP and SSH support.

SFTP Net Drive
SFTP Net Drive is a commercial Windows software that lets you work with a remote file system as if it were a local disk drive, provided the remote system supports SFTP protocol. It's a straightforward WinSshFS 4every1 alternative for users whose primary need is SFTP access and local drive mapping without additional complexities. The software is designed for simplicity and efficient SFTP file management.

e-nautia
e-nautia is a free web-based platform that offers a dedicated space for storing and sharing files, communicating, and managing emails. While not a direct desktop-to-remote-drive mapping tool like WinSshFS 4every1, it serves as an alternative for cloud storage and file sharing needs, offering an Ftp server and email server functionality within a web environment. It's suitable for users prioritizing web-based access and collaborative features over local drive integration.

FTPDrive
FTPDrive is a free Windows software that creates virtual drives linked to configured FTP servers. Unlike WinSshFS 4every1 which focuses on SFTP, FTPDrive caters specifically to FTP. This allows users to work with FTP from any program, even if it lacks a built-in FTP client. It's a simple yet effective alternative for those primarily dealing with FTP connections and needing to access them like local drives.
